Algorithm for evaluating hourly radiation utilizability function

A computationally simple algorithm is presented for evaluating the hourly utilizability function, /phi/, defined as the fraction of the long-term monthly-average hourly solar radiation incident on a surface which exceeds a specified threshold intensity. The hourly utilizability approach can be used for any azimuth and allows a different threshold intensity to be defined for each hour of the day. If needed, daily utilizability for any orientation can be found by summing results over a day. Hourly results are shown to compare favorably both with an analytical expression for /phi/ developed recently and with results obtained from many years of hourly horizontal radiation measurements.
